We spend 90% of our time indoors. Yet most buildings were made for aesthetics and efficiency, ignoring the biology that sustains your drive and well-being over the long run.

We tune a building to the body. Five biological signals, calibrated in complete unison — so you stay sharper, sleep deeper, and carry less stress.

Five biological signals, calibrated in complete unison.

Circadian light keeps the body clock aligned and your energy stable.

Fractal visual patterns in light and surface give the brain structure it can process with less effort, lowering background stress.

Clean air with subtle natural compounds keeps the space feeling clear and the mind sharp over long days.

Slow, deliberate thermal cycles let the body settle instead of fighting sudden shifts in temperature.

Low frequency ambient rhythms give the nervous system a calm, steady baseline.

Engineered to align with your physiology, whenever and wherever you need it.

Morning. Light rises gradually from night into day. The air carries a clean, precise scent your brain reads as time to wake.
Your body registers the day before you open your eyes. You wake clear, not jolted.

Deep work. Cool, precise light tightens the visual field and the room grows quiet at the edges. Distraction drops away and your attention locks onto the work in front of you. You stay in that state longer, without strain.

Evening. Light softens into amber and the room starts to slow your breathing. Airflow settles and the temperature eases down. Your system begins to release the day without you having to decide to stop.

Night. The room falls fully dark and sound settles to a steady floor. Fresh, silent air keeps every breath effortless. Sleep runs deep and uninterrupted, so you wake with real reserves.
